How can I use mock in Django views for testing?
You can use the unittest.mock
module to mock dependencies in your Django views. This allows you to isolate the view logic from external services.
Can you give me a code example of how to mock a database call in a Django view?
Sure! Here's a simple example:
from django.test import TestCase
from unittest.mock import patch
from .views import my_view
class MyViewTest(TestCase):
@patch('myapp.models.MyModel.objects.get')
def test_my_view(self, mock_get):
mock_get.return_value = MyModel(name='Test')
response = self.client.get('/my-view/')
self.assertEqual(response.status_code, 200)
What are some common pitfalls when using mock in Django testing?
Common pitfalls include over-mocking, which can lead to tests that don't accurately reflect real behavior, and forgetting to reset mocks between tests.
